New Delhi, Feb 18: Arvind Kejriwal's guru Anna Hazare seems to have forgot his previous statements in which he vowed not to support any political leader or party. But quite contrary to his words, the Gandhian crusader now has been seen praising and supporting Mamata Banerjee in her campaigns for Lok Sabha election which is due by May 2014.

Praising the West Bengal CM during his Kolkata visit, Anna earlier had called Mamata is a "ray of hope". The Trinamool Congress leader and Anna are all set to meet in Delhi on Tuesday, Feb 18.

Anna, who earlier had criticised Arvind Kejriwal for launching his own political party AAP and did not even allow AAP members on stage during his fast protest at his hometown Ralegan Siddhi, Maharashtra, surprised everyone.

Anna, during his meeting with Mamata's aides, had said, "We see a ray of hope in her. If people start backing such leaders than it will not take much time for the country to change."

He noted that Banerjee wore slippers, a simple sari, and did not take salary as chief minister. "Mukul Roy has come with a message from Mamata. I will go to meet her in Delhi. There we will discuss in detail on what path we will take," Hazare told reporters after meeting the TMC general secretary Mukul Roy at his village Ralegan Siddhi in Ahmednagar district.

The Gandhian activist said he had proposed a 17-point agenda for political parties in implementing a list of programmes in Parliament after the Lok Sabha polls if voted to power, which only Mamata had accepted.
